Output 8c3e853b2a42767a68cac3bd7c389e128ae9bd60afcd0058a28f73d38d08b087:5

value
2066900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76f04c3bf23a54fc73f5e430a049a3c5f4887690 OP_EQUALVERIFY OP_CHECKSIG
address
1BqtbpWXYgEUX8WbKGZiJ3L9PBMj8UKtYq
transaction
8c3e853b2a42767a68cac3bd7c389e128ae9bd60afcd0058a28f73d38d08b087
spent
true